Filters:

department of social services in Nouaceur

About 16 results.

Pursangs-web

Hafiz Maroc

SMKA services

Intelcia (Morocco Headquarters)

Boulevard Al Qods, Casablanca, Morocco

OFPPT

IBM Maroc

Route Sidi Maarouf, الدار البيضاء, Morocco
  • 1